本文章僅供自己參考:
系統及軟件配置爲Win7 X64旗艦版,VWmare9,BT5R3。
在網上看過大量的文章講到,在WIN7下VWmare的NAT模式不能再共享上網,只有用橋接或者Host-only模式纔可以。但經過自己反覆折騰,依然沒有在橋接模式下達成上網的願望,so 以host-only模式實現了虛擬機內BT5的上網。
一、WIN7系統中的設置:
1、虛擬網卡共享上網:
打開“網絡和共享中心”-->“更改配置器設置”-->設置相關參數
2、打開“VMware Network Adapter VMnet1”的屬性(host-only模式下默認使用該虛擬網卡),設置網卡IP address及netmask。該地址是要跟BT5在一個網段裏,它將作爲BT5的網關地址存在。
3、打開“本地連接”的屬性項,設置網絡共享及需要共享的虛擬網卡。
二、在BT5中的參數設置:
在BT5中,網卡手動設置非常簡單:
首先打開終端:
IP地址設置命令如下:
ifconfig eth0 192.168.137.2 netmask 255.255.255.0
默認網關設置命令如下:
route add default gw 192.168.137.1
其它方法的補充:
自動獲取IP
dhclient eth2
臨時設置IP地址
ifconfig eth2 192.168.132.112/24 設置IP和子網掩碼
route add default gw 192.168.1.1 設置網關地址
ech2 nameserver 192.168.1.1 > /etc/resolv.conf 設置DNS地址
/etc/init.d/networking restart 重啓網卡
設置靜態IP
ifconfig -a 查看所有網卡
vi /etc/network/interfaces 編輯IP地址
auto eth2
#iface eth2 inet dhcp
iface eth2 inet static
address 192.168.132.112 (IP地址)
netmask 255.255.255.0 (子網掩碼)
network 192.168.132.0 (網絡地址)
broadcast 192.168.132.255 (廣播地址)
gateway 192.168.132.254 (網關地址)
/etc/init.d/networking restart 重啓網卡
vi /etc/resolv.conf 編輯DNS
update-rc.d networking defaults 設置系統啓動後自動啓用網卡
無線網絡設置
/etc/init.d/wicd start 啓動wicd
三、在虛擬機的網絡設置中改爲“host-only”模式,就基本能上網了。
總結:
具體問題具體分析,目前這種方式是可以上網的。